Judith T. Zeitlin, Professor in the Department of East Asian Languages and Civilizations at the University of Chicago, will explore the creation of Ghost Village, an experimental opera based on a ghost story from Pu Songling’s Liaozhai zhiyi. The project is a collaboration between scholar and librettist Judith Zeitlin and composer Yao Chen, a Beijing-based professor trained in Chicago.
